1. What is AI here

Kansumi uses third-party AI models to read floor plans and sketches, generate and edit interior images, and answer chat messages. Depending on configuration, requests are processed by fal, OpenRouter, Groq, OpenAI, Anthropic or a model self-hosted by the operator of this deployment, together with the model developers behind them; providers and models can change. Interior renders, including initial concepts, regenerations, style changes and edits, are AI-generated images. They are not photographs and not the work of an architect, engineer or designer. The assistant is automated. Data handling is described in the Privacy Policy.

2. What can be wrong, and what to trust

AI output can be inaccurate, inconsistent between runs, unsuitable, or impossible to build. What to trust:

  • The 2D plan is the measurement. Renders take cues from it but are not dimensionally reliable.
  • Extraction is AI-assisted. Walls, doors, windows and scale detected from a drawing can be wrong. Confirming one dimension sets the scale but does not verify the rest, so check and correct the scene before generating.
  • Photo projects have no plan. Projects created from a room photo produce no measured plan.
  • The assistant is not verified. Its answers about fit, clearance, products, prices or rules are probabilistic.

None of this is professional or safety advice; the Terms of Service set out the rules on construction and professional reliance.

3. How output is labeled

Stored renders and PNG exports are designed to carry signed C2PA Content Credentials that identify them as AI-generated; PDF exports keep the credentials inside the embedded page images. Free-tier renders and exports also carry a visible "Made with Kansumi" watermark; Pro renders normally do not. Credentials and watermarks can be lost through screenshots, messaging apps, conversion or editing, and a credential proves provenance, not accuracy.

4. Similarity, safety systems and contact

Output may resemble other users' output or existing designs, products or copyrighted works. You own your Output under the Terms, but you are responsible for checking it and for any rights you need before publishing it. Automated file checks and provider safety systems may block lawful material or miss harmful material, and provider outages or model changes can delay or prevent output; when an action fails before delivering, its reserved credits are released.
